Understanding the Symptoms of Anxiety: A Comprehensive GuideAnxiety is a natural reaction to stress and can manifest in different kinds, from everyday apprehension to devastating conditions. As one of the most typical psychological health problems, anxiety effects countless individuals internationally. Recognizing the symptoms is vital for timely intervention and management. This post will explore the symptoms of anxiety, providing a comprehensive summary through tables, lists, and FAQs, to provide a detailed understanding of this prevalent condition.What is Anxiety?Anxiety is a psychological and physiological reaction to viewed risks or stressors. It is identified by extreme worry, fear, and unease. While occasional anxiety is a regular part of life, chronic anxiety can hinder daily activities and overall well-being. Categories of Anxiety DisordersBefore diving into the symptoms, it is essential to understand the primary types of anxiety conditions:Type of Anxiety DisorderDefinitionGeneralized Anxiety Disorder (GAD)Persistent and excessive stress over different elements of life.Panic attackRepeating anxiety attack identified by intense fear and physical symptoms.Social Anxiety DisorderIntense fear of social circumstances and being judged by others.Particular PhobiasUnreasonable worries of particular items or situations.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D)Involuntary thoughts (obsessions) and repetitive behaviors (compulsions).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D)Anxiety following exposure to a terrible event.Common Symptoms of AnxietySymptoms of anxiety can be both mental and physical. Understanding these symptoms is essential to recognizing anxiety in oneself or others. Mental SymptomsPsychological symptoms are typically the most identifiable indications of anxiety. They can vary in intensity and might include:Psychological SymptomDescriptionExtreme WorryConsistent and uncontrollable stress over different aspects of life.RestlessnessFeeling on edge, unable to unwind, or experiencing racing ideas.Trouble ConcentratingDifficulty focusing or a sense that your mind is going blank.IrritabilityIncreased level of sensitivity to stress or disappointment.Sleep DisturbancesProblem dropping off to sleep, remaining asleep, or experiencing agitated sleep.Physical SymptomsAnxiety can likewise manifest physically, leading to numerous health concerns. Typical physical symptoms consist of:Physical SymptomDescriptionIncreased Heart RateFast or racing heartbeat, often felt in anxiety attack.Shortness of BreathFeeling like you can not take a deep breath or experiencing tightness.Muscle TensionTightness in muscles, causing pain or pain.SweatingExtreme sweating, especially in social circumstances or during panic.Gastrointestinal IssuesQueasiness, diarrhea, or other digestion disturbances.DizzinessFeeling lightheaded or faint, often related to panic attacks.Table: Summary of Anxiety SymptomsHere's a summed up table of both psychological and physical symptoms of anxiety:CategorySymptomsMentalExtreme worry, restlessness, problem concentrating, irritation, sleep disruptionsPhysicalIncreased heart rate, shortness of breath, muscle stress, sweating, intestinal concerns, dizzinessWhen to Seek HelpIf anxiety symptoms hinder life, relationships, or work, it's necessary to seek aid. Early intervention can result in efficient treatment, which might include treatment, medication, or way of life changes.Frequently Asked Questions about Anxiety Symptoms1. What causes anxiety symptoms?Anxiety symptoms can emerge from a mix of hereditary, ecological, and mental aspects. Stressful life events, injury, and even particular medical conditions can add to the advancement of anxiety conditions.2. Are anxiety symptoms the same for everybody?No, anxiety symptoms can differ significantly from person to individual. Some may experience primarily mental symptoms, while others may have more noticable physical symptoms.3. Can anxiety symptoms be managed without medication?Yes, many individuals handle their anxiety through treatment (such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y), mindfulness practices, workout, and way of life changes. However, for some, medication may be essential.4. For how long do anxiety Symptoms Of An Anxiety last?The duration of anxiety symptoms can vary commonly. Some experience short-term symptoms activated by a specific stress factor, while others may have persistent symptoms that last for months or perhaps years.5. Is it possible for anxiety symptoms to imitate other health issues?Yes, anxiety symptoms can simulate physical health problems, such as heart conditions or intestinal disorders. It's vital to seek advice from a health care expert to rule out other potential causes.Anxiety symptoms can be complicated and multifaceted, affecting both psychological and physical health. Understanding these symptoms is important for acknowledging the condition in oneself or others. Early intervention can significantly enhance quality of life and minimize the impact of anxiety on daily activities. If you or somebody you understand is experiencing symptoms of anxiety, it may be useful to look for professional help. With the ideal assistance and treatment, managing anxiety is possible, allowing individuals to lead satisfying lives.
